Output 66b8a7fe2d64c2871754fca4d8cf7db88f8e6dcde73cff8e659f68e9f586c40b:0

value
79999000
script pubkey
OP_0 OP_PUSHBYTES_20 bdd700498644eafff90c6801dd495a66fff89672
address
bc1qhhtsqjvxgn40l7gvdqqa6j26vmll39njt23yy5
transaction
66b8a7fe2d64c2871754fca4d8cf7db88f8e6dcde73cff8e659f68e9f586c40b
confirmations
33742
spent
true